The first Friday of every month is Gallery Stroll Night in downtown Provo. Along with other cool galleries, Provo Community United Church of Christ is one location you do not want to miss. On April 1st from 6-9 pm we will be displaying religious Easter symbols of a wide variety. If you have any symbols and would like to display them please have them at the church by 4pm on that day. Light refreshments will be served.

Deciding to share is tough sometimes, especially when we feel we barely have enough to get by ourselves. But compared to people whose lives have been ravaged by disaster, or who live on less than $1 a day, we have a great abundance.

This week we are invited to help people in need around the world and in communities impacted by disasters in the United States through the One Great Hour of Sharing (OGHS) offering. As the church, we are called to help one another, even through the sharing of our own resources.

“Entering the Lenten season is always a bit of a perplexing situation. We go into Lent knowing it as a time of increased devotion, fasting and generosity – but also understanding these practices of discipleship are traits we want to hold dear in our walk of faith at all times”, writes the Rev. Geoffrey A. Black, General Minister and President of the United Church of Christ.

Our Episcopal friends will be holding a Liturgy of Ash Wednesday at 12 noon and 7 pm today. This day marks the first day of Lent. We begin by acknowledging our humanity, reminding ourselves that we are mortal and imperfect but for the grace of God. We place ashes on our foreheads in humility acknowledging our need for God’s grace and mercy. We ask Divine forgiveness for our failure to love and we receive Divine Food for the 40-day journey of Lent in Holy Eucharist.
